  • Patent number: 4046387
    Abstract: A plastic pipe system is provided with a device for indicating the presence of a gasket after final system installation. The pipe system preferably is constructed from a suitable plastic material, and includes a first pipe and a second pipe, the second being formed to receive an end of the first pipe along a connection part formed in the pipe. The connection part includes a receptacle sized to receive a suitable gasket. The gasket is inserted in the receptacle and provides a fluid seal between the two pipe ends. The second pipe has an opening formed in a side wall of the pipe defining the gasket receiving receptacle, and an indicator tab is placed through the opening. The tab preferably is attached to or integrally formed with the gasket, and aids in ensuring proper positioning of the gasket in the receptacle. After insertion, the tab permits easy visual inspection of the pipe system, enabling verification of actual gasket presence in the pipe system.
